About Stockbridge, VT

Stockbridge is located in Vermont. Stockbridge, Vermont has a population of 788. Stockbridge is less family-centric than the surrounding county with 19% households with children. The county percentage for households with children is 22%.

The median household income in Stockbridge, Vermont is $66,538. The median household income for the surrounding county is $64,073 compared to the national median of $66,222. The median age of people living in Stockbridge is 50 years.

Stockbridge Weather

The average high temperature in July is 81.14 degrees, with an average low temperature in January of 4.06 degrees. The annual precipitation is 43.75.
